Mysterious is a distinctive floribunda rose bred by Nola M. Simpson in New Zealand and offered exclusively in the U.S. through Jackson & Perkins. Created with compact gardens in mind, this charming floribunda rose, is part of the J&P Roses Around the World Collection, a series that celebrates rare, internationally bred roses of exceptional beauty and performance. Mysterious honors Simpson's legacy of developing hardy, healthy selections—an approach carried forward today by her nephew, John Ford—bringing gardeners a rose that is truly uncommon in both color and character.

Blooming abundantly in recurring waves from late spring through mid fall, Mysterious produces 3-inch semidouble flowers with 9 to 16 petals in an intriguing russet brown shade that softens at the cream-toned center. These small clusters of blooms lend a warm, earthy elegance to the landscape, and their mild fragrance makes them ideal for cutting; a single snip creates a striking and unusual bouquet. This compact floribunda has an upright habit and glossy, healthy foliage that provides a clean backdrop for its richly colored blooms, ensuring a polished and appealing presence throughout the growing season.

Highly versatile and easy to grow, Mysterious thrives in full sun and well-drained soil, performing reliably in patios, small gardens, and container plantings where space is limited but beauty is a must. It also integrates seamlessly into mixed borders, low hedges, and broader landscape designs thanks to its excellent disease resistance and steady flower production. Genus Rosa
Species hybrida
Variety 'SIMpansy'
Zone 5 - 9
Bloom Start to End Late Spring - Mid Fall
Habit Compact
Height 3 ft
Width 24 in
Bloom Size 3 in
Petal Count 16
Item Form Bareroot Grafted
Additional Characteristics Repeat Bloomer, Bloom First Year
Bloom Color Red, Brown
Foliage Color Medium Green, Glossy
Fragrance Light
Light Requirements Full Sun
Moisture Requirements Moist,  well-drained
Resistance Disease Resistant
Soil Tolerance Normal,  loamy
Uses Beds, Border, Outdoor, Landscapes
